Kotak AMC, executives seek settlement in Essel Group debt dispute
The case dates back to the 2019 Essel liquidity crisis, when a sharp fall in Zee Entertainment's share price triggered margin calls on pledged shares securing debt held by six Kotak fixed maturity plans (FMPs). The case relates to Kotak Mutual Fund's six close-ended debt schemes (FMPs), which had invested in zero coupon non-convertible debentures (NCDs) issued by Konti Infrapower & Multiventures and Edison Utility Works, part of the Essel Group, the promoter group of Zee Entertainment Enterprises.

ASK Property Fund to raise Rs 3,500 crore for housing-focused debt strategy
ASK Property Fund is launching a new Rs 3,500 crore debt fund. This fund will finance residential projects in key Indian cities like Mumbai, Delhi NCR, Pune, Bengaluru, Chennai, and Hyderabad. The fund aims to support developers with structured financing for mid-segment housing. It will also focus on lender replacement and completing stalled projects.

AIA Engineering shares surge as Street cheers 38% profit jump; company to pay ₹16 dividend
AIA Engineering highlighted that anti-dumping and countervailing duties imposed by the United States on certain high chrome grinding media imports from India remain effective from June 12, 2025. The duties include a 3.16% countervailing duty and 6.91% anti-dumping duty.

Zee Entertainment Q4 Results: Company Slips To Rs 100-Crore Net Loss, Revenue Falls 7%; Dividend Declared
Revenue declined over 7% to Rs 2,025 crore, compared to Rs 2,184 crore in the corresponding quarter of the last fiscal.
Strong digital business boosts ENIL FY26 revenue 3.9% to Rs 565 crore
Entertainment Network India, or ENIL, saw its revenue climb to ₹565 crore in FY26. This growth was powered by its digital business, which expanded significantly. The company's radio advertising market faced challenges. ENIL's digital segment now contributes substantially to its overall revenue. The company maintained a strong financial position and recommended a dividend.
